Licensing and Regulatory Compliance for Canadian Players
When evaluating fresh online casinos, the very first factor to look at is the licensing and regulatory framework that governs the political program. For Canadian players, the landscape is unique because there is no federal official gambling authority; instead, provinces regularise gambling activities. However, most reputable internet casinos serving Canada hold licenses from international jurisdictions that are recognized globally for their stringent standards. The most respected among these include the Malta Gaming Authority, the United Kingdom Gambling Commission, and the Kahnawake Gaming Commission—the latter beingness particularly relevant as it is based in Canada. The Kahnawake Gaming Commission, established by the Mohawk Council of Kahnawake, has been licensing internet gambling operators since 1999 and is known for its rigorous inadvertence. A casino with a Kahnawake license demonstrates a dedication to fairness, security, and responsible gaming. Additionally, some brand-new casinos may hold licenses from the Isle of Man or Calpe, both of which also enforce strict player protection rules. When assessing a new casino, players should verify the license list and check the regulator’s website to ensure the license is valid and not suspended. Licensed casinos are required to use certified random number generators, undergo regular audits by third-party testing agencies such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, and segregate player funds from operational accounts. This ensures that winnings are paid out promptly and that the games are genuinely random. Moreover, Canadian players benefit from the fact that licensed casinos must hold fast to anti-money laundering protocols and data protection laws, which safeguard personal and financial entropy. It is also important to take note that while Curacao licenses are common among newer casinos, they are considered less stringent. Therefore, for Canadian players, antecedency should be given to casinos holding licenses from Kahnawake, Malta, or the UKGC, as these supply the highest tear down of consumer protection. In 2026, the regulatory surround continues to evolve, with more provinces like Ontario implementing their own iGaming marketplace, requiring operators to register with the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ario. This make a motion towards provincial regularisation adds another layer of protection for Canadian players. Consequently, when evaluating new casinos, one should look for those that have obtained an Ontario license or are actively pursuing it, as this demonstrates a willingness to comply with local laws. Ultimately, a strong licensing foundation is the non-negotiable starting point for any casino recommendation, as it directly impacts the safety and reliability of the gaming experience.
Welcome Bonuses and Promotional Offers
New web-based casinos often attract players with enticing welcome bonuses, but a thorough evaluation requires looking for beyond the headline offer. The bonus amount might be large, but the conditions find its true value. Wagering requirements, typically exp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ount (e.g., 35x or 45x), indicate how many times you must play through the bonus before you can withdraw any profits. Lower requirements are preferable; anything higher up 50x is generally considered excellent and less player-friendly. Additionally, the product contribution percentages matter: slots usually reckoning 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ette may count only if 10% or even cypher. New casinos may also impose maximum bet limits while using a bonus, often around $5 or $10 per spin. Another crucial aspect is the maximum cashout limit, which caps the amount you can pull from bonus winnings. A low cap, such as $100, can severely limit your potential gains. Furthermore, the bonus expiration period is important; most bonuses must be used within 7 to 30 days of claiming. For Canadian players, it is also essential to check if the bonus is available for well-known payment methods like Interac e-Transfer, as some bonuses exclude certain deposit methods. Free spins offers are vulgar, but they often come with their have restrictions, such as a limited number of games where the spins can be used and a maximum win limit. Some new casinos give a no-deposit bonus, which provides a small amount of bonus cash or free spins just for registering. These are excellent for testing a casino without financial commitment, but they typically have very high wagering requirements and lowest maximum cashouts. When evaluating welcome packages, consider the in general fairness: a reasonable wagering requirement (30x or bring down), a long expiration period (30+ days), and a high maximum cashout are signs of a generous give.
